Report: Pirates Catcher Elias Diaz's Mother Kidnapped In Venezuela
Photo credit: Mark Tenally/ [object Object] The Pirates have released a statement in response to reports that catcher Elias Diaz’s mother has been kidnapped in Venezuela:
The alleged kidnapping was first reported by Venezuelan journalist Mari Montes.
Kidnapping has long been a problem for Venezuelan baseball players, who often have to spend extra resources protecting themselves and their families when they are in the country. Rays catcher Wilson Ramos was himself kidnapped in the country in 2011, and in 2009 family members of former Rockies catcher Yorvit Torrealba and former Rays pitcher Victor Zambrano were kidnapped in Venezeula.
